How to Reverse a linked list
In this video, we are going to look at one of the famous interview questions on linked list: reversing a linkedlist. Description: Given the head of a singly linked list, reverse the list, and return the reversed list. Input: head 1, 2, 3, 4, 5 Output: 5, 4, 3, 2, 1 Link: Each element in a linked list consists of two parts: Data: This part stores the data value of the node. That is the information to be stored at the current node. Next Pointer: This is the pointer variable or any other variable which stores the address of the next node in the memory.
